Datametrex AI loses $4.32-million in Q2 2023

2023-08-29 17:28 ET - News Release

Mr. Marshall Gunter reports

DATAMETREX ANNOUNCES Q2 FINANCIAL RESULTS

Datametrex AI Ltd. has released the second quarter (Q2 2023) financial results for the company. The company has filed its financial statements and management discussion and analysis on SEDAR+ for the six months ended on June, 2023 (Q2 2023).

Financial highlights

The company reported revenue of $4,912,584, which includes $1,844,054 earned from big data and artificial intelligence solutions, approximately $1-million in revenue from reaching certain milestones on its government of Canada contract, and health care revenue of $3,068,530.

At June 30, 2023, the company had current assets of $9.3-million, including cash of $3.5-million.

Normal course issuer bid (NCIB) share buyback program

The company has purchased a total of 34,198,000 common shares of the company for an aggregate amount of $3,574,073.36 through the NCIB share buyback program.

Q2 highlights

In the second quarter, the company appointed Charles Park as the new chief operating officer to further strengthen its management team and drive growth across its business units.

The company achieved a significant milestone by successfully completing its AnalyticsGPT beta program for its new GPT software. As beta testing wrapped up, preparations swiftly commenced for the impending launch of AnalyticsGPT, tailored for businesses.

Additionally, the company's DM EVS subsidiary announced a five-year partnership agreement with Holiday Inn Vancouver as the exclusive provider of EV charging services for the hotel's West Broadway establishment. Under the terms of the agreement, DM EVS will install chargers on the Holiday Inn's property and will be providing guests and visitors with convenient access to reliable EV charging infrastructure.

Medi-Call Inc.

Medi-Call reports a 10-per-cent increase in subscribers, boasting 477 subscribers to date compared with the last report, which showed a total of 432 subscribers in May, 2023. This figure marks growth from the previous report and a 69-per-cent rise from the April, 2023, count of 281 subscribers.
